Job description

Master Automotive Technician (FT) 60K to 90+K.

Are you into Jeep's and Jeep's performance? Inland Jeep is a family-owned and operated Jeep performance, fabrication restoration, and repair shop. At Inland Jeep we strive to create a positive and challenging workplace that promotes excellence and achievement, aiming to deliver the very best experience possible to our employees and customers. We are looking for dedicated and motivated professionals who share that same passion to join our team.

Responsibilities:
  • Receives repair orders and performs work as outlined on repair orders.
  • Diagnoses malfunctions and performs/documents repair.
  • Works closely with the shop foreman, managers, and other service employees.
  • Examines vehicles to see if additional service is needed.
  • Road-tests vehicles.
  • Maintains a safe and clean workspace.
  • Follows all safety-related policies, procedures, and laws.
Qualifications:
  • Three to Five years of experience.
  • Excellent knowledge of mechanical, electrical, and electronic components of vehicles.
  • Working knowledge of vehicle diagnostic systems and methods.
  • Ability to handle various tools and heavy equipment (e.g. lift).
  • Willingness to observe all safety precautions for protection against accidents, dangerous fluids, chemicals, etc.
  • Valid CA driver's license and good driving record.
  • Must be authorized to work in the United States.
  • Attention to detail and workmanship.
  • Basic computer skills.
  • Skilled in written communication.
  • A high school diploma is preferred; Certification from a vocational school or completion of an apprenticeship is preferred.
  • Valid ASE certification(s) is a definite plus.

Skills:
  • Repair brake and steering systems.
  • Diagnose and repair electrical and electronic systems.
  • Replace or repair fuel components as needed.
  • Repair cooling components and systems including air conditioners and engine cooling.
  • Perform emissions inspections, safety checks, and similar state-regulated vehicle examinations.
  • Maintain a clean, safe working environment.
  • Produce legible and accurate paperwork reflecting work performed.
  • Possess a valid state driver’s license for conducting test drives.
  • Possession of or ability to obtain training credentials like an ASE certification.
  • Strong written and verbal communication skills.
  • Analytical skills.
  • Experience using hand and power tools to replace and repair parts.
